Objective:

To collect 37 batches of Scrophulariae Radix decoction pieces from the market as the research object, and to establish a quality grade standard of Scrophulariae Radix decoction pieces based on the correlation between quantitative appearance characteristics and intrinsic quality.

Methods:

According to the traditional quality evaluation method, 37 batches of Scrophulariae Radix decoction pieces were divided into two grades—A and B. Their appearance characteristics were quantified while their moisture, ash, leaching and intrinsic quality indexes were detected, respectively. Finally, the independent sample t test analysis, orthogonal partial least squares discriminant analysis (OPLS-DA) and Pearson correlation analysis were carried out to reveal the correlation between appearance characteristics and intrinsic quality.

Results:

On the basis of meeting the quality control standard of Scrophulariae Radix recorded in the 2020 edition of the Pharmacopoeia of the People's Republic of China(referred to as Chinese Pharmacopoeia, ChP), it was found that water-soluble extractives and alcohol-soluble extractives were the key indexes for the grades classification of Scrophulariae Radix decoction pieces. In summary, the lower the chromatic value and the greater the density(ρ)of Scrophulariae Radix decoction pieces, the higher the water-soluble extractives and the lower the alcohol-soluble extractives. The grading quality standard of “selected goods” and “gradeless and uniformly priced goods” of Scrophulariae Radix decoction pieces were preliminarily drawn up: the chromatic value(E*ab)of “selected goods” of Scrophulariae Radix decoction pieces should be less than or equal to 5.5, the ρ of Scrophulariae Radix decoction pieces should be greater than or equal to 1.4 g·cm-3, and the content of water-soluble extractives should be greater than or equal to 77%, the value of E*ab of “gradeless and uniformly priced goods” of Scrophulariae Radix decoction pieces should be between 5.5 and 14, the value of ρ should be between 0.8 and 1.4 g·cm-3, and the content of water-soluble extractives should be greater than or equal to 60%.

Conclusion:

The appearance characteristics of Scrophulariae Radix decoction pieces are related with the internal quality, which is consistent with the traditional quality evaluation method, and it is convenient to scientifically judge the internal quality of Scrophulariae Radix decoction pieces from its appearance characteristics.
